New York and London: McGraw-Hill Book Company, Inc.. Very Good- with no dust jacket. 1928. 1st Edition, 3rd Impression. Hardcover. In glazed hessian cloth covered boards with the title in gilt to the spine on a brown, gilt bordered, title block. A little rubbed with a few light and a few fairly negligible marks from age/ storage, but overall Near VG. Page fore-edges lightly browned, with some tiny spotting to the top edge, and a few marks generally, but Overall Tight and Clean. (xiv) + 701 pp. Black and white photos, diagrams and line drawings throughout. Light browning to the plain endpapers, and a former owner's name and date written in ink to the top of the front free endpaper, o/w Very Clean and unmarked. Contents include : - Preface to the American Edition; Preface to the German Edition; 1. Introduction. 2. The Thallus. 3. Reproductive organs.4. Sexual Organs and Sexuality. 5. Archimycetes. 6. Phycomycetes. 7. Chytridiales. 8. Oomycetes. 9. Zygomycetes. 10. Ascomycetes. 11. Hemiascomycetes-Endomycetales. 12. Taphrinales. 13. Euascomycetes-Plectascales. 14. Perisporiales. 15. Myriangiales. 16. Hypocreales. 17. Sphaeriales. 18. Dothideales. 19. Hysteriales. 20. Hemisphaeriales. 21. Phacidiales. 22. Pezizales. 23. Tuberales. 24. Laboulbeniales. 25. Basidiomycetes. 26. Polyporales. 27. Agaricales. 28. Gasteromycetes. 29. Tremellales. 30. Cantharellales. 31. Dacryomycetales. 32. Auriculariales. 33. Uredinales. 34. Ustilaginales. 35. Fungi Imperfecti. 36. Review of Fungus Classification. 37. Bibliography. Index. Heavy Book.
